Mobile Patrol Guard (field Support)

Scarborough, ON, Canada

Job Description


The position of the Wincon Field Support is to aid the Operations Team in their day-to-day operations. The incumbent is required to follow the directions of the various operations team members to ensure sites staffing needs are covered, transports are provided for guards when needed, and attending to other duties as assigned. Remains alert to emergency situations and provides front-line response, alarm response, emergency management, and/or referral if required.

Job Qualifications:

  • Must have a valid security guard license under the Ontario Private Security & Investigative Services Act, 2005.
  • Must have a valid First Aid Certificate & CPR Certificate
  • Must possess a valid G license or equivalent.
  • Must be 25 years or older (for automobile insurance purposes)
  • Must provide Driver’s Abstract, without demerit points, dated within 30 days of hiring.
  • Must possess own automobile insurance.
  • Must be able to meet and maintain any applicable provincial licensing requirements for mobile security guards.
  • One-year relevant experience is required.
  • Must be able to successfully complete a company administered road test.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Excellent inter-personal, problem-solving, decision making and critical thinking skills
  • Willing and able to travel to various client site locations via company vehicle.
  • Able to work independently without close supervision.
  • Must be able to walk, run, stand for extended periods of time, in addition to climbing stairs.
  • Knowledge of CB radio and Condo Control Central software usage, preferred.

Responsibilities and duties:

Operations:
  • Cross training at all Wincon client locations and reviewing and acknowledging of Post Orders for all sites.
  • Transporting of employees to and from workplaces as assigned to a designated spot
  • Ensure safe and proper operation of Wincon Security Patrol vehicle when responding to dispatch calls.
  • Respond to major incidents on properties and aid security staff with managing the situation (fire, flood, medical issue, and criminal activity) and alarm response services as directed by the Site Supervisor or Wincon Management
  • Protects evidence or scene of incident in the event of accidents, emergencies, or security investigations
  • Demonstrated ability to respond to questions with patience, courtesy, and tact.
  • Inspect buildings, grounds, for unsecure doors and windows and security devices; monitor and set security devices.
  • Enforce Provincial statues and municipal by-laws.
  • Parking enforcement of assigned properties.
  • Coordinate towing of unauthorized vehicles in accordance with Security Staff and municipal rules and regulations
  • Promote safety and adhere to client site emergency procedures.
  • Reinforce company policies regarding COVID-19 protocols
  • To ensure the condominium safety and emergency procedures are followed in response to fire alarms and other site emergencies
  • Set up barriers and signage and provide direction or information to others.
  • Ensure parking enforcement of assigned properties and coordinate towing of unauthorized vehicles in accordance with security staff and municipal rules and regulations.
  • Write reports of all incidents that occur on customer sites.
  • Mandatory attendance at court when requested by the municipality to provide evidence for tickets that were issued.
  • Be responsible to ensure all equipment is maintained in proper working condition. If there is an issue, advise Operations Coordinator and/or Operations Manage
  • Perform any other duties, as assigned.
